"I need you here" - Message from Smile

Smile is a non-player based myth that is rumored to have terrorized players from the years 2011 to 2013. No recent reports of players having received messages from Smile have been seen. However unreported incidents can happen, which means Smile can still be out there.

Description

Smile is often depicted as being in two forms, his player avatar, and his in-game counterpart. The player avatar is solid black, with large white eyes and a large smile across its face, lined with razor-sharp teeth. The in-game counter-part is a hovering cloud with the same face as the player, with two large hands hovering just below it. No true avatar has been found matching the descriptions given, which means it could be a bug or manipulated page that players get sent to, rather than a true player.

Background

Several years ago, in 2011, there was a report of a player named  █████ receiving DMs from an 'unclickable' account named Smile. These DMs were always titled "Smile", and always contained the words "I need you here" within, with a link to a game. He had been harassed by these DMs for a little over a month and was growing tired of it.

He eventually gave in and clicked the game link, which automatically caused him to join. When he joined, he described it as a pitch black, smoke-filled room, with a noticeably larger smile, hovering at the other end and tracking his movement with its gaze. He was unable to close out of the game. He walked closer to it, and as he got closer, the game got laggier, until his entire computer crashed.

When the player rebooted his computer, his wallpaper was a screenshot of him in the game with Smile. Which he couldn't change. Startled by all of this, he got in contact with hunters who documented all of this information. They told him to keep in contact in case anything else happened. A hunter named ████████ tried contacting the player three days later, but found the account no longer existed, the hunter, thinking it was a termination, thought nothing of it, and forgot about the player.

Later however a friend of the player approached the hunter and informed him that the player had committed suicide and had carved a huge smile on his face, from ear to ear. His friend also reported that the player had said he had been having night terrors involving a figure with a large smile on his face. His parents reported hearing no noises from his room apart from loud laughing on the night of his suicide.

About a year later two hunters, by the names of ██████████ and ███████ were both contacted by an account saying "I need you here" from a user also by the name of Smile, they both decided this would be a good opportunity to get information on Smile so they decided to join the game together, and they took the only screenshots of Smile ever taken.

Later in the week, both hunters reported having extremely painful headaches. They both joked about it, saying it was "The Smile effect getting to them". Then that night both accounts went inactive and their avatars turned black with smiles on them, these smiles matched the smile of the Smile from the screenshots these hunters took earlier that week. Then both accounts completely disappeared. A fellow hunter, who knew both the names of the vanished hunters, researched news articles that were similar to the article from the last Smile Incident, the hunter then found that both hunters had committed suicide, with the same smile carved into their face as the previous victim, and with the same loud laughing coming from their rooms.
